Google.org grants $50 million to nonprofits striving for equal access in education

 According to a report from Google.org, the search giant’s philanthropic arm, 74% of students globally have little or no internet connectivity, 221 million students in schools are being taught in a language that is foreign to them, and 32 million students school-aged children can’t even reach traditional classrooms because of violent conflict and displacement.
